Red Cat (NASDAQ:RCAT) Trading 6.2% Higher – Should You Buy?

Red Cat Holdings, Inc. (NASDAQ:RCATGet Free Report)’s stock price rose 6.2% during mid-day trading on Friday . The stock traded as high as $9.31 and last traded at $9.21. 10,143,291 shares were traded during mid-day trading, a decline of 27% from the average daily volume of 13,952,317 shares. The stock had previously closed at $8.67.

Red Cat News Roundup

Here are the key news stories impacting Red Cat this week:

  • Positive Sentiment: HC Wainwright reaffirmed its Buy rating and maintained a $20 price target, implying substantial upside from the recent share price. The endorsement suggests the firm remains confident in Red Cat’s growth prospects. Benzinga article
  • Positive Sentiment: Red Cat reported 527% year-over-year revenue growth for the second quarter. Gross margin rose 39% from the prior-year quarter and increased 27% sequentially, indicating improving operating performance and demand for its drone products. Business Insider article
  • Neutral Sentiment: Management guided for fiscal 2026 revenue of $150 million to $180 million, broadly surrounding the $155.4 million analyst consensus. The range signals continued expansion but does not clearly represent a major forecast upgrade.
  • Neutral Sentiment: Needham lowered its price target from $20 to $15 while retaining a Buy rating. The target reduction reflects more cautious valuation assumptions, though the firm still sees meaningful upside. The Fly article
  • Negative Sentiment: Second-quarter results fell short of expectations: Red Cat reported an adjusted loss of $0.26 per share versus the expected $0.21 loss, while revenue of $20.2 million missed the $22.65 million consensus. The company remains deeply unprofitable, which could pressure the stock despite its growth rate. Zacks article

Red Cat Trading Up 6.2%

The firm has a market cap of $1.13 billion, a PE ratio of -13.16 and a beta of 1.31. The firm’s 50 day simple moving average is $9.99 and its 200 day simple moving average is $11.85.

Red Cat (NASDAQ:RCATGet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, August 6th. The company reported ($0.26) ear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of ($0.21) by ($0.05). Red Cat had a negative return on equity of 35.86% and a negative net margin of 138.36%.The firm had revenue of $20.20 million for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$22.65 million. As a group, equities research analysts predict that Red Cat Holdings, Inc. will post -0.68 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About Red Cat

(Get Free Report)

Red Cat Holdings, Inc (NASDAQ: RCAT) is a technology holding company that develops and delivers advanced robotics, autonomy, and sensing solutions for defense, national security, public safety and commercial customers. Headquartered in American Fork, Utah, the company brings together a portfolio of specialized operating businesses focused on unmanned aerial systems (UAS), mission management software, precision mapping sensors and engineering services.

Through its UAS segment, Red Cat designs and manufactures small to medium-sized fixed-wing and vertical-takeoff drones that support intelligence, surveillance and reconnaissance (ISR) missions.
